Founder's X - Wayne is an AI-powered platform that connects early-stage startup founders with relevant investors, co-founders, and business opportunities tailored to their specific stage and industry. Instead of manually networking or waiting for warm introductions, Wayne uses AI to surface high-probability connections and deal flow in real time. For bootstrapped founders juggling product development and fundraising, this cuts weeks off the networking timeline and dramatically increases the quality of introductions you receive.
The tool integrates with your Twitter presence and founder profile to understand your startup's needs, stage, and sector. It then matches you with potential investors actively looking to fund companies like yours, other founders solving adjacent problems, and strategic partnership opportunities.
